To solve the equation \( x - 6 = -16 \), we can isolate \( x \) by adding 6 to both sides. Here are the steps:

  1. Start with the equation: \[ x - 6 = -16 \]

  2. Add 6 to both sides: \[ x - 6 + 6 = -16 + 6 \]

  3. Simplify: \[ x = -10 \]

So the solution is \( x = -10 \).
